Lyrics

Beautiful an­them the first Christ­mas wak­ened
Ages ago ov­er Beth­le­hem’s plain;
Greeting the shep­herds with ma­gic­al accents,
Bringing de­li­ver­ance from sin’s deep stain.

Refrain

Ring out a wel­come to Christ­mas’ fair morn­ing,
Herald its com­ing, each fresh, youth­ful voice;
Ring out a wel­come, a bright cheery wel­come!
Christmas is dawn­ing, let earth re­joice!

Peerless the sing­ers, and won­drous their sing­ing;
Glorious theme: Lo, a Sav­ior is born!
Royal De­liv­er­er, His prais­es are ring­ing,
Hailing with joy the aus­pi­cious morn!

Refrain

Shall we not join in the loud, swell­ing cho­rus
Sending the mes­sage from mount­ain to sea;
Let fair­est Peace spread her dove-like wings o’er us,
Making our hearts His fit home to be.

Refrain
